Frequently Asked Questions about Leinkauf

What type of rentals are currently available in Leinkauf?

There are currently 104 Apartments for Rent in Leinkauf, AL with pricing that ranges from $695 to $11,551. There are also 64 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Leinkauf ranging from $650 to $2,800.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Leinkauf?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Leinkauf ranges from $650 to $2,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,628.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Leinkauf?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Leinkauf range from $1,269 to $4,141,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$1,775.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,450 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,883.
